Neurons are the structural and functional unit of the nervous system. Based on the transmission of nerve impulse these neurons can be divided into two divisions :

1. Afferent neurons: Neurons which transmit the impulse from the periphery to CNS- brain or spinal cord. Sensory neurons are such neurons which carry the impulse of stimulus to CNS.

2. Efferent neurons: Neurons which transmit the signals from the CNS to the periphery or muscle which causes voluntary action. Motor neurons are considered efferent neurons.

Diabetic neuropathy _____.
Pie
Diabetic neuropathy most often damages nerves in your legs and feet. Depending on the affected nerves, diabetic neuropathy symptoms can range from pain and numbness in your legs and feet to problems with your digestive system, urinary tract, blood vessels and heart. Some people have mild symptoms.
